U.S. v. Lloyd, No. 94-3665 (7th Cir.) (71 F.3d 1256) (December 5, 1995) (Judge John L. Coffey)
The Seventh Circuit approves the use of evidence, under Rule 404(b), showing that the defendant was a
member of a street gang and that he had been subject to two assassination attempts in the past year. The
defendant was charged with being a felon in possession of a gun, and …
